Moscow plays a vital role in global supply chains, especially in the context of European supply chains. As the capital city of Russia, Moscow is not only a political and cultural hub but also a significant economic center that forms a crucial link in the supply chain networks connecting Europe and Asia.
One key factor that positions Moscow prominently in European supply chains is its strategic geographical location. Situated at the crossroads of Europe and Asia, Moscow serves as a gateway for goods moving between the two continents. The city's well-developed transportation infrastructure, including its extensive network of highways, railways, and airports, further enhances its role as a logistical hub for supply chain operations.
In recent years, Moscow has seen a rise in foreign investment and the establishment of distribution centers by multinational corporations looking to expand their presence in the region. These investments have helped strengthen Moscow's position in European supply chains by facilitating the smooth flow of goods and materials across borders.
Moreover, Moscow's status as a major financial center and technology hub has also contributed to its importance in global supply chains. The city's robust banking and IT sectors provide essential support services for supply chain management, including payment processing, data analytics, and inventory tracking.
In addition to its logistical and economic advantages, Moscow offers a skilled workforce and a business-friendly environment that attract companies looking to optimize their supply chain operations. The city's focus on innovation and sustainability further enhances its appeal as a strategic location for businesses seeking to develop efficient and environmentally conscious supply chains.
Overall, Moscow's central position in Europe, coupled with its strong infrastructure, financial services, and talent pool, positions the city as a key player in global supply chains. As businesses continue to explore new markets and expand their operations, Moscow is likely to remain a pivotal node in the ever-evolving network of international trade and commerce.
